Below my right side passenger peg on my 2001 FXDWG is this filter. I'm thinking its a breather of some sort. The hose it connects to runs up under the tank to either the rocker boxes, carb, or gas tank. I can trace it past the rear rocker, but lose it there, as I haven't removed the tank.
So the filter unit broke off. It seems there should be a flange the hose attaches to the has come off. Part of this broken flange is still in the hose, held in with a hose clamp.
So, what's it called? I need to get a replacement. It's pretty oily, that's why a breather came to mind....
Here is how the breather is routed on my Softail, those are the crankcase and transmission breather hoses. A filter on the end serves no purpose other than to get nasty looking.
